基于MBD的框类组件数字化制造方法应用

摘    要:大型框类组件的制造采用数字化制造方法具有很大优越性,本文论述了将MBD技术应用于框类组件的数字化制造中的方法,给出了框类组件的数字化协调路线以及MBD环境下的数字标工建立方法及应用方法,对提高大型框类组件的制造技术水平并显著缩短制造周期具有重要现实意义。

Application of Digital Manufacturing Method in Subassembly of Frame Kind Based on MBD

Abstract:There is a large superiority in digitalize manufacturing of large subassembly of frame kind. In this paper the method of application of MBD technology to subassembly of frame kind digital manufacturing is discussed. Digital coordination line of subassembly of frame kind and designing method of digital master tooling and its applying method on MBD environment is provided. It has important practical meaning in improving our subassembly of frame kind manufacturing technology and shorting its manufacturing cycle.
